1. Specifications Comparison
Feature |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ra |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2023) | Practical Impact |
---|---|---|---|
Design | |||
Dimensions (mm) | 163.4 x 78.1 x 8.9 | 162.8 x 73.8 x 9.2 | S23 Ultra slightly taller and narrower, both similar thickness. Negligible difference in everyday use. |
Weight (g) | 234 | 202 | S23 Ultra noticeably heavier; may be tiring for extended one-handed use. |
Build | Glass front & back, aluminum frame | Plastic frame | S23 Ultra feels more premium and durable. |
Display | |||
Display Type | Dynamic AMOLED 2X | IPS LCD | S23 Ultra offers significantly better contrast, deeper blacks, and more vibrant colors. Noticeable difference in visual quality, especially in outdoor viewing. |
Display Size (inches) | 6.8 | 6.6 | S23 Ultra slightly larger; more immersive for media consumption. |
Resolution | 1440 x 3088 | 1080 x 2400 | S23 Ultra much sharper; noticeable difference in text clarity and image detail. |
Refresh Rate (Hz) | 120 | 120 | Both offer smooth scrolling and animations. |
Peak Brightness (nits) | 1750 | Not specified | S23 Ultra likely significantly brighter; crucial for outdoor readability. Missing spec for Moto limits comparison. |
Performance | |||
Chipset |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 (4 nm) | Snapdragon 6 Gen 1 (4 nm) | S23 Ultra significantly more powerful; noticeable difference in demanding tasks like gaming and multitasking. |
CPU | Octa-core (1x3.36 GHz Cortex-X3 & 2x2.8 GHz Cortex-A715 & 2x2.8 GHz Cortex-A710 & 3x2.0 GHz Cortex-A510) | Octa-core (4x2.2 GHz Cortex-A78 & 4x1.8 GHz Cortex-A55) | S23 Ultra's superior CPU architecture and clock speeds result in faster app loading, smoother performance, and better responsiveness. |
GPU | Adreno 740 | Adreno 710 | S23 Ultra's GPU provides a substantial advantage in gaming performance and graphics-intensive applications. |
RAM | 8GB/12GB | 4GB/6GB/8GB | S23 Ultra offers more RAM in its higher configurations, enhancing multitasking and overall performance. |
Camera | |||
Main Camera (MP) | 200 | 50 | S23 Ultra boasts significantly higher resolution, potentially capturing more detail. However, megapixels alone don't determine image quality. |
Zoom | 10x Optical, 100x Digital | Digital Zoom (unspecified) | S23 Ultra offers superior zoom capabilities, especially at longer ranges. Missing Moto spec limits detailed comparison. |
Video Recording | Up to 8K@30fps | Up to 4K@30fps | S23 Ultra allows for higher resolution video recording. |
Battery | |||
Capacity (mAh) | 5000 | 5000 | Similar battery capacity suggests comparable battery life, but real-world usage may vary due to different processors and displays. |
Fast Charging | 45W | 20W | S23 Ultra charges significantly faster. |
2. Key Differences Analysis
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ra Advantages:
- Superior Display: Noticeably better visual experience with brighter, more vibrant colors and sharper details.
- Flagship Performance: Significantly faster and smoother for demanding tasks and gaming.
- Advanced Camera System: Higher resolution, superior zoom capabilities, and 8K video recording.
- Faster Charging: Significantly reduces charging time.
- Premium Build: More durable and luxurious feel.
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2023) Advantages:
- Lighter Weight: More comfortable for extended one-handed use.
- Lower Price: Significantly more affordable.
- Stylus Support: Offers unique note-taking and drawing capabilities (not detailed in provided specs, but assumed based on model name).
